This specimen was lot 40648 in Stack's Bowers NYINC sale (New York, January 2023), where it sold for $432. The catalog description[1] noted, "BRAZIL. 400 Reis, 1734-R. Rio de Janeiro Mint. Joao V. PCGS AU-53." This type was struck in Minas Gerais 1730-34 and in Rio in 1734.
Recorded mintage: unknown.
Specification: 0.89 g, 0.917 fine gold, this specimen 0.99 g.
Catalog reference: Fr-60; KM-152; Gomes-107.01.
